**Ticket: Config drift in extracted user module**

While carving the user module out of the Harkwell monolith, we found the new `userd` service and the monolith disagree on session TTLs and password policy knobs. New folks: always change both until the monolith path is deleted. The canonical values `userd` should be running with are listed below.

service settings:
WENATH_PIN=5007
WENATH_METRICS_HOST=metrics.wenath.tolvaqlabs.corp
WENATH_LOG_LEVEL=debug
WENATH_TENANT=rusox

**Mgmt Meeting Minutes — Retiring the Brightline Range**

Quick recap for sales leads at Fenholt Supplies: we agreed to retire the Brightline fixture range by year-end. Remaining stock moves to clearance pricing next month, and accounts on standing orders get migrated to the Lumetta range. Trade-in incentives were approved in principle. The confidential note on next steps sits just below.

board note of bajof-bajeg: The pricing group signed off on a budget of $13.4 million for Project Sildor. The renewal with Lamixek Holdings closes at $48.9 million a year, 49 percent above the last contract.

Handover note — Crumbwheel order cutoffs.

Welcome aboard. The bakery cutoff rule in Crumbwheel closes same-day orders at 14:00 local to each storefront, not UTC — this has bitten us twice. Holiday overrides live in the calendar service and take precedence silently, so always check there first when a cutoff looks wrong. To unlock the calendar service's admin console after a restart, enter the recovery passphrase below.

vault phrase of bagap-bahaf = silion-pelox-sorox-casdor-quenwyn-fraax-eliox-praael-kelion-quenvan-kasox-rusael-norius-belvan

Quick heads-up before Thursday's rollout: cold starts on the Fernbolt order handlers were hitting 4–6 seconds because the warmup ping wasn't authenticated and got dropped at the gateway. The fix is the new pre-warm hook in `deploy/warmup.sh`, which fires right after the stack settles. For it to work, the handler env file needs `WARMUP_CONCURRENCY=3` and `WARMUP_REGION=east`. One more thing: the hook authenticates with the gateway, so right after those two lines add the credential it signs with.

sealed setting: VAULT_KEY20=c8ea1e419912889df6b4